Step 1
Place garlic and zest into mixing bowl and chop 10 sec/speed 8.
Step 2
Scrape down sides of mixing bowl with spatula and repeat chopping 10 sec/speed 8.
Step 3
Add capers, egg yolks, Dijon mustard and lemon juice and mix 30 sec/speed 4. Scrape down sides of mixing bowl with spatula
Step 4
Place a jug onto mixing bowl lid and weigh oil into it.
Step 5
Mix 2-3 min/speed 4, slowly pouring oil onto mixing bowl lid, letting it trickle into mixing bowl to emulsify (see Tips).
Step 6
Season with salt to taste, then mix 4 sec/speed 4.
Step 7
Transfer into a sealable jar or container and refrigerate until ready to serve.
